Lazern Nov 2, 2019 @ 10:05am 
Found a fix for me in my inn. I previously had stairs to 2nd floor only in the main hall so all of my employees would have to go through the main hall in order to get to the staff room or do something upstairs, in other words making it dirtier each time. I set up another pair of stairs in the back of my establishment and it helped with some of the dirt in the main hall.

I have 1 - 2 servants entirely dedicated to cleaning and set to max speed priority (they also have the speedy trait), along with 3 drudges who help in between with low cleaning priority. Rest of my servants are only serving the tables.

Sometimes when there's a monster rush or my cleaners are on break I usually close the inn to make sure no more guests enter. I also take advantage of this downtime and order stuff that I need and open again once it's clean/restocked. I still get spammed with poor service but I rarely notice any guest complaining about dirty rooms and instead get compliments about it's cleanliness and get fame points.

P.S Setting a room as a max priority for cleaning doesn't seem to work, so I don't bother with it. The AI only seem to get confused by it and wander around the inn aimlessly.

OAF Nov 2, 2019 @ 4:27pm 
I found some stoves may make this situation.
When stove dirties floor with soot, employees are willing to clean it madly. However, if the stove is set too close to the wall or other objects, they sometimes can't reach the soot between them and the tasks to clean soot are left and piled up. The priority of these tasks seem to be higher than to clean rooms. So employees wouldn't' clean rooms such as main hall.

When I moved the stove in the middle of the kitchen, many employees rushed to the black soot. And they started to clean rooms well after they had finished cleaning the soot.
